Wolff says Bottas-Russell swap rumours ‘nonsense'

May 6 Toto Wolff has dismissed as 'nonsense' reports suggesting he may replace Valtteri Bottas with George Russell before the end of the 2021 season. When asked about the rumours by Osterreich newspaper, including the assertion that Lewis Hamilton is ‘almost always' ahead of Bottas, the Mercedes team boss replied: 'Nonsense. 'Bottas is really good – he can take on anyone in the field. And again and again he is able to drive faster than Lewis, like last time in Portimao qualifying,' said Wolff.
